Reacher‘s spinoff Neagley introduced plenty of twists and turns — but the biggest surprise might have been Jerry O’Connell‘s surprise cameo.
“He was pretty much our first choice for this,” creator Nicholas Wootton exclusively told Us ahead of the show’s Wednesday, September 16, premiere. “I can’t remember anybody else that we even thought of.”
The first season of the new Prime Video show introduced a concerning drug about to hit the market. A fake commercial showed O’Connell serving as the face of the medication, which allowed the actor to lean into his comedic side.
“Just seeing Jerry O’Connell and how he showed up so ready to roll. He was so funny and a sweetheart of a guy as ever existed,” Wootton gushed. “Man, he just nailed it. Like he was so perfect.”

He continued, “I remember we just started. We’re just like, ‘Oh my god.’ And it was like he got it and he understood it. He got the joke. He understood that this was kind of crazy and wacky in the middle of this show. Nothing but praise for Jerry.”
Reacher, which concluded its fourth season on Wednesday, is based on the Jack Reacher novel series by Lee Child. It stars Alan Ritchson as the main character, a self-proclaimed drifter and former U.S. Army military police officer with incredible strength, intellect and abilities.
Prime VideoDuring his travels, Reacher crosses paths with dangerous criminals and battles them. Neagley (Maria Sten), for her part, was introduced on Reacher before making the switch to her own show.

The first season of her own show, streaming now, focused on Neagley seeking the truth after an old friend died in a suspicious accident.
In addition to Sten, Greyston Holt, Jasper Jones, Adeline Rudolph, Matthew Del Negro and Damon Herriman made up the rest of the cast. But it was O’Connell that captured everyone’s attention on set.
“Jerry was a nice cameo,” Holt told Us. “Stand by me is my favorite movie of all time but I didn’t actually see him. I wasn’t on set when he was there. But just knowing he was a part of it, I was like a little fanboy.”
Jones had a similar experience, saying, “I took a selfie with him at an elevator at Comic Con once.”
